Photochemical Smog: [O3] depends on the ratio and on [VOC] Generally, [VOC] [O3] BUT If VOC are in excess, changing [VOC] has little effect; [NOx] [O3] If [VOC] is low relative to [NOx], a situation can occur where [NOx] [O3] Why? VOC, NOx compete forOH [NOx] more VOC reacts w/ OH  [O3]
